Costa Pacifica Location

Costa Pacifica is ideally situated in the vibrant Sabang Beach area of Baler, Aurora, Philippines. Located approximately 230 kilometres northeast of Manila, this coastal haven offers a refreshing escape from the city bustle. The resort is directly accessible from the main road, placing you within easy reach of the area's natural wonders and local culture. Costa Pacifica Nearby Attractions and Activities

Baler, Aurora, is rich in natural beauty and historical significance, offering a plethora of activities for visitors.
  • Sabang Beach:

    Famous for its consistent surf breaks, Sabang Beach is a must-visit for surfers of all levels. It's also a beautiful spot for leisurely walks and enjoying the sunrise.
  • Baler Church (San Luis Obispo de Tolosa Parish Church):

    A historical landmark dating back to the Spanish colonial era, this church holds significant cultural and architectural importance.
  • Diguisit Beach and Rock Formations:

    Known for its unique rock formations and picturesque coves, Diguisit offers stunning photo opportunities and a more secluded beach experience.
  • Baler Museum:

    Explore the local history and heritage of Baler and Aurora province at this informative museum.
  • Clemente's Point:

    Another popular surf spot, offering different wave conditions and a vibrant local surf scene.

How to Get to Costa Pacifica from the Airport

Getting to Costa Pacifica from the nearest major airport, Clark International Airport (CRK) or Ninoy Aquino International Airport (NAIA) in Manila, involves a scenic drive. The airport transfer service of Costa Pacifica can be arranged to ensure a smooth journey.
  • Private Transfer:

    The most convenient option is to arrange a private car or van transfer directly from the airport. This can be booked in advance through the hotel or a reputable service. The journey from Manila typically takes 4-6 hours, depending on traffic. Estimated cost for a private transfer from Manila is around AUD $150 - $250, depending on vehicle size and service.
  • Bus and Van Services:

    Several bus companies operate routes from Manila to Baler. You can take a bus from terminals in Cubao or Pasay to Baler town proper. From Baler town, you can take a tricycle or a short taxi ride to Costa Pacifica. The bus fare is approximately AUD $10 - $20.
  • Ride-hailing Services:

    While direct ride-hailing services from the airport to Baler are not common, you can use them to reach a bus terminal in Manila.

Though Costa Pacifica maintains to be still the most “luxurious” resort in Baler, the maintenance did not bode well during our stay. For starters, the floor was still wet when we got to our room, a Junior Suite. The edges around the bed had a brownish stain. The sheets on the bed were crusty. The pillow case had few stains on it, too and the sofa seat was just plain disgusting that I wouldn’t even place my clothes there. There were also no room slippers provided. There was also no separating door—just a screen— between the toilet and the shower, so when you shower, it floods the floor. The airconditioner unit was cold but was leaking. Also had only few breakfast viants in the morning. Just longanissa and some fish. Previously in the past, they were serving tapa, tocino or even corned beef. The quality dialed down definitely. Good part was the impeccable service. We were checked in immediately. There were complimentary goods for us when we got there. There was a small refrigerator and complimentary drinks. The pool was still cute. There were free surfing lessons included in the package as well. There are still lots of improvement and updating that could happen but still would go back to Costa Pacifica, hoping to get better experience next time.

My husband treated me to a 3-day 2-night stay at this resort. When I found out how much he paid for the trip, I thought it is quite pricey considering the kind of service we got and the lack of cleanliness of the room. We stayed in an ocean-view room on the first floor. The room was priced at Php 9k/night with breakfast. There’s a sofa with filthy cover (see photo). The sheets smelled bad as if it wasn’t properly dried (kulob smell). We’ve asked twice to be transferred to a different room but the other building is undergoing construction. The room is spacious but pretty standard-looking. The minibar was free but it was not refilled on our second night. Coffeemaker wasn't working. I had to manually filter the coffee. The front desk officer when we checked in seemed too tired to offer information about our accommodation. I didn't know we had free surfing lessons; I had to ask later on for it and only then was I informed that we need to get a voucher for it. It was also through a Google search when I found out that Dicasalarin cove can be visited by Costa guests at a discounted rate (they own the cove!). I, later on, found out that my husband asked the reservation people if they can do something special for my birthday. Nothing came, not even a slice of cake waiting in our room (hahah!). Costa Pacifica boasts itself of the most luxurious accommodation in Baler. We’ve experienced luxury in other resorts (with the same rate) and what we had in Costa is far from being luxurious.
